WebFeb 17, 2024 · Variables can be declared by var, let, and const keywords. Before ES6 there is only a var keyword available to declare a JavaScript variable. Global Variables are the variables that can be accessed from anywhere in the program. These are the variables that are declared in the main body of the source code and outside all the functions. WebApr 3, 2024 · Arrays can be created using a constructor with a single number parameter. An array is created with its length property set to that number, and the array elements are empty slots. const arrayEmpty = new Array(2); console.log(arrayEmpty.length); … value. WebMar 4, 2024 · What is an Array? An array is an object that can store a collection of items. Arrays become really useful when you need to store large amounts of data of the same type. Suppose you want to store details of 500 employees. If you are using variables, you will have to create 500 variables whereas you can do the same with a single array.
WebApr 3, 2024 · The Array.of () static method creates a new Array instance from a variable number of arguments, regardless of number or type of the arguments. Try it Syntax Array.of(element0) Array.of(element0, element1) Array.of(element0, element1, /* … ,*/ elementN) Parameters elementN Elements used to create the array.
